- 方向:
- 全て ウェブ3.0 バックエンド開発 ウェブフロントエンド データベース 運用・保守 開発ツール PHPフレームワーク よくある問題 他の 技術 CMS チュートリアル Java システムチュートリアル コンピューターのチュートリアル ハードウェアチュートリアル モバイルチュートリアル ソフトウェアチュートリアル モバイル ゲームのチュートリアル
- 分類する:
-
- Goで選択したステートメントを使用するには、複数のチャネルを同時に処理するにはどうすればよいですか?
- この記事では、同時チャネル操作のGOのSelectステートメントを使用して、その構文、非ブロッキング通信などの利点、およびデッドロックの防止方法に焦点を当てています。
- Golang 646 2025-03-26 13:35:40
-
- Goのチャネルの仕組みを説明します。バッファーチャネルとバッファーされていないチャネルとは何ですか?
- Goのチャネルは、ゴルチン通信を促進し、バッファーされていないチャネルが操作を同期し、バッファリングされたチャネルを使用して、ブロッキングの送信/受信を可能にします。
- Golang 827 2025-03-26 13:33:44
-
- ゴルチンとは何ですか?それらはスレッドとどのように違いますか?
- GORoutines in goは、Goランタイムによって管理される軽量のスレッドで、効率的な並行性を提供します。安全な通信のためにチャネルを使用して、よりリソース効率が高く、管理が容易になることにより、従来のスレッドとは異なります。
- Golang 240 2025-03-26 13:32:33
-
- GOの構造体とは何ですか?どのような構造体を別の構造に埋め込むことができますか?
- この記事では、GOの構造体と1つの構造体を別の構造に埋め込み、単純化された構文や改善されたコードの再利用性などの利点を強調し、フィールドアクセスルールと一般的なユースケースの説明について説明します。
- Golang 893 2025-03-26 13:31:30
-
- Goで弦はどのように表されていますか?それらは可変または不変ですか?
- Go文字列は、連結やスライスなどの特定の操作を伴うバイトの不変のシーケンスです。ベストプラクティスは、効率的な文字列処理手法を通じてメモリ使用量を最適化することに焦点を当てています。
- Golang 713 2025-03-26 13:30:32
-
- GOの配列とスライスの違いは何ですか?なぜスライスがより一般的に使用されるのですか?
- この記事では、GOの配列とスライスの違いについて説明し、その使用、効率、およびメモリ管理に焦点を当てています。スライスは、柔軟性と効率性に適しています。配列は、固定サイズのシナリオに適しています。
- Golang 1026 2025-03-26 13:29:37
-
- GOのIOTAキーワードは何ですか?定数を定義するためにどのように使用されますか?
- この記事では、一連の定数を効率的に定義するために使用されるGoのIOTAキーワードについて説明しています。それは、酵素やビットフラグなどの実用的な例について説明し、簡潔さや読みやすさなどの利点を強調しています。
- Golang 1022 2025-03-26 13:28:31
-
- Goの組み込みエラー処理メカニズムとは何ですか?エラーをどのように効果的に処理しますか?
- この記事では、GOのエラー処理メカニズムについて説明し、即時処理、エラーラップ、および特異性とコンテキストの改善のためにカスタムエラータイプなどのエラータイプとベストプラクティスに焦点を当てています。
- Golang 764 2025-03-26 13:27:34
-
- GOメソッドのバリューレシーバーとポインターレシーバーの違いを説明します。いつそれぞれを使用しますか?
- この記事では、GOメソッドの価値とポインターレシーバーについて説明し、その違い、使用シナリオ、パフォーマンスへの影響、メソッド呼び出しへの影響に焦点を当てています。ポインターレシーバーは、状態を変更し、大きなタイプの処理に有益です。[159
- Golang 769 2025-03-26 13:25:41
-
- GoのDeferステートメントを使用することの利点は何ですか?それがどのように機能するかを説明してください。
- この記事では、Goの延期声明の利点と仕組みについて説明し、リソース管理、コードの読みやすさ、エラー処理におけるその役割を強調しています。さまざまなシナリオでリソース管理を延期する方法を詳しく説明しています。
- Golang 276 2025-03-26 13:23:43
-
- Pythonのミキシンとは何ですか?コードの再利用にどのように使用できますか?
- Pythonのミキシンは、クラスの階層全体でコードを再利用できるようにし、従来の継承に対する柔軟性とモジュール性を提供します。彼らは深い相続とダイヤモンドの問題を避けるのに役立ちます。
- Python チュートリアル 176 2025-03-26 13:21:38
-
- 「quot; duck typing」の概念を説明するPythonで。その利点と短所は何ですか?
- この記事では、PythonでのDuckタイピングについて説明します。これにより、オブジェクトはそのタイプではなく動作に基づいて使用できます。柔軟性やランタイムエラーなどの短所などの利点を調べ、効果的なベストプラクティスを提供します
- Python チュートリアル 716 2025-03-26 13:20:43
-
- Pythonの抽象的な基本クラス(ABC)とは何ですか?彼らはどのようにインターフェイスを実施しますか?
- 記事では、Pythonの抽象的な基本クラス(ABC)、インターフェイスの実施における役割、およびコードの再利用性やタイプチェックなどの利点について説明します。
- Python チュートリアル 232 2025-03-26 13:19:30
-
- Pythonの浅いコピーとディープコピーの違いを説明してください。どうすれば深いコピーを作成できますか?
- この記事では、Pythonの浅いコピーと深いコピーについて説明し、その違いと使用シナリオに焦点を当てています。浅いコピーはネストされたオブジェクトを参照しますが、深いコピーは再帰的にそれらを複製します。ディープコピーにはcopy.deepcopy()を使用します。
- Python チュートリアル 830 2025-03-26 13:18:39
-
- Pythonのプロパティデコレーターはどのように機能しますか?マネージド属性を作成するためにどのように使用できますか?
- この記事では、Pythonのプロパティデコレータについて説明します。これにより、メソッドは属性のようにアクセスでき、Getter、Setter、およびDeleter関数を使用して管理された属性を可能にします。カプセル化、検証、改善されたコードrなどの利点を強調しています
- Python チュートリアル 553 2025-03-26 13:16:48